JPMorgan Chase Fines Exceed $2 Billion

JPMorgan Chase Fines Exceed $2 billion for violations of the Bank Secrecy Act tied to failure to report suspicious activity related to Bernie Madoff’s Ponzi scheme. The fines against Chase were the result of three settlements. The U.S. Attorney’s Office for the Southern District of New York included a $1.7 billion penalty. The Treasury Department’s Financial Crimes Enforcement Network fined Chase $461 million for BSA-related violations. The OCC issued a cease and desist order directing Chase’s three affiliated banks to correct deficiencies in their compliance programs.”]
